Embodiment 1
[0079] First, a disc-shaped substrate 11 made of polycarbonate resin having a thickness of 1.1 mm, an outer shape of 120 mm, and an inner diameter of the center hole 12 of 15 mm was formed by injection molding. (Illustration omitted) The substrate 11 has a spiral groove 11 b having a track pitch of 0.32 μm on one of the main surfaces 11 a side. In addition, concentric first grooves 11c1 and second grooves 11c2 with a pitch of 0.4mm, a groove width of 0.2mm, and a groove depth of 0.1mm are provided at a distance of 22mm to 44mm from the center of the substrate. Furthermore, a preliminary groove 11c0 is provided between the first groove 11c1 and the spiral groove 11b.
[0080] Next, as shown in FIG. 2(A), on the side of one main surface 11a where the spiral groove 11b is formed on the substrate 11, a 100nm-thick film is formed by sputtering so as to cover the spiral groove 11b. Light reflection layer 13 made of Ag alloy.
